What is the formula for slope and y-intercept?
y = mx + b
The slope intercept formula y = mx + b is used when you know the slope of the line to be examined and the point given is also the y intercept (0, b). In the formula, b represents the y value of the y intercept point.

How do you find the equation and y-intercept from a graph?
Since two points determine any line, we can graph lines using the x- and y-intercepts. To find the x-intercept, set y=0 and solve for x. To find the y-intercept, set x=0 and solve for y. This method of finding x- and y-intercepts will be used throughout our study of algebra because it works for any equation.

How do you find a linear equation?
Steps to find the equation of a line from two points:
- Find the slope using the slope formula.
- Use the slope and one of the points to solve for the y-intercept (b).
- Once you know the value for m and the value for b, you can plug these into the slope-intercept form of a line (y = mx + b) to get the equation for the line.
How do you find the equation of a line?
To find an equation of a line given the slope and a point.
- Identify the slope.
- Identify the point.
- Substitute the values into the point-slope form, y − y 1 = m ( x − x 1 ) . y − y 1 = m ( x − x 1 ) .
- Write the equation in slope-intercept form.

How do you find linear equations?
The slope-intercept form of a linear equation is y = mx + b. In the equation, x and y are the variables. The numbers m and b give the slope of the line (m) and the value of y when x is 0 (b). The value of y when x is 0 is called the y-intercept because (0,y) is the point at which the line crosses the y-axis.

How to graph given slope?
– When reading the graph from left to right, the line rises if the slope is positive. – When reading the graph from left to right, the line falls if the slope is negative. – The line gets steeper as the absolute value of the slope get larger. (look at the numeral of the slope, not the sign) – For example a slope of 2 is steeper than a slope of 1/4.
